A blog and a forum are both online platforms that allow users to share information and engage in discussions, but they have distinct differences. 

A blog is typically a personal or professional website where an individual or a group of individuals regularly post articles or entries on a specific topic. The content is usually written in a more formal and structured manner, with the author(s) providing their own perspective or expertise. Readers can leave comments on the blog posts, but the primary focus is on the author's content.

On the other hand, a forum is an online discussion platform where users can create threads or topics and engage in conversations with other users. Forums are more community-driven, allowing users to start discussions, ask questions, and share their opinions. The content is usually less formal and more conversational, with multiple users contributing to the discussion. Forums often have different categories or sub-forums to organize topics based on specific interests or themes.

In summary, while both blogs and forums facilitate online communication and information sharing, blogs are more focused on individual or group-authored content, while forums prioritize user-generated discussions and interactions.

A blog is a website or an online platform where an individual or a group of individuals share their thoughts, opinions, and experiences through written content. It is typically a one-way communication channel where readers can engage by leaving comments. On the other hand, a forum is an online discussion platform where users can create and participate in conversations on various topics. It allows for multi-directional communication, enabling users to start new threads, reply to existing ones, and engage in discussions with other members. Unlike a blog, a forum is more community-oriented and encourages active participation from its users.

Blogs and forums differ primarily in their content structure and focus.

Blogs feature content that revolves around the blog owner's ideas, opinions, interests, and experiences. Blog posts generally take the form of long-form articles and commentary expressing the author's viewpoint. Readers are welcome to leave comments, but the primary voice belongs to the blogger. Content is arranged chronologically, with the most recent posts appearing first.

In contrast, a forum is a place where many users converse and interact with each other. Instead of focusing on one author's viewpoint, forums focus on questions, debates, and discussions on specific topics. Discussions are typically organized into threads and subforums. New topics can be started or existing exchanges can be updated by users. Instead of a single author, the blog is written by a community of participants.

An owner's blog emphasizes their individual opinions and commentary, whereas a forum provides a platform for conversation between users. A blog presents content, whereas a forum hosts discussions.
